Data compiled as indicated in comments:
MS - José A. Martinho Simões
AC - William E. Acree, Jr., James S. Chickos

Quantity Value Units Method Reference Comment
Δvap42.1 ± 0.4kJ/molCC-SBSokolovskii and Baev, 1984Another value for the enthalpy of vaporization has been reported: 45.6 ± 2.5 kJ/mol Hatch, Sutherland, et al., 1949.; MS

Enthalpy of vaporization

ΔvapH (kJ/mol) Temperature (K) Reference Comment
42.1 ± 0.4341.Sokolovskii and Baev, 1984, 2Based on data from 313. to 370. K.; AC
